Beau A. Sampley is a graduate student at the University of Arkansas – Fort Smith. His research focuses on vehicle design for extraterrestrial environments, as evidenced by his 2024 publication, "Dynamic Wheelbase for a Lunar Terrain Vehicle (LTV)." This work investigates adaptive suspension systems to improve mobility and stability on varied lunar surfaces. Sampley collaborates with researchers from Arkansas State University and within his own institution, including Kevin R. Lewelling, London A. Bossett, and Evan B. Piovesan, with whom he has co-authored publications. His academic work contributes to the field of robotic vehicle engineering for space exploration.
